The Founding of Pereira
Pereira was founded on August 30, 1863, by a group of settlers led by Francisco Pereira Martínez. The city was named in honor of this pioneer who played a crucial role in its establishment. The settlement was part of a broader wave of colonization that sought to populate and develop the coffee-rich region of Colombia.
The Coffee Boom
In the late 19th and early 20th centuries, Pereira experienced significant growth due to the coffee boom. The fertile soil and favorable climate of the region made it an ideal location for coffee cultivation. This period saw an influx of settlers and the establishment of numerous coffee plantations, which became the backbone of the local economy.
The Railway Connection
The construction of the railway in the early 20th century was a pivotal moment for Pereira. The railway connected the city to other major urban centers in Colombia, facilitating the transport of coffee and other goods. This development significantly boosted trade and commerce, contributing to the city's rapid growth and modernization.
Economic Diversification
While coffee remained a key economic driver, Pereira diversified its economy in the mid-20th century. The city saw the rise of various industries, including textiles, metallurgy, and manufacturing. This diversification helped stabilize the local economy and provided employment opportunities beyond the agricultural sector.
Cultural and Educational Development
Pereira has also been a center for cultural and educational development. The establishment of institutions like the Technological University of Pereira in 1958 played a significant role in advancing education and research in the region. The city also hosts various cultural festivals and events, reflecting its rich heritage and vibrant community life.
